The ingredients needed to make Easy! Salmon Fried in Leek Miso Paste:
  1. Get 2 fillets Fresh salmon
  2. Make ready 5 cm length Japanese leek
  3. Get 25 grams ☆ Miso
  4. Take 4 grams ☆ Sake
  5. Take 1 cm ☆ Ginger paste in tube
  6. Make ready 1/2 tbsp Vegetable oil
Steps to make Easy! Salmon Fried in Leek Miso Paste:
  1. Cut the leek vertically, then against the grain to obtain a fine mince. Mix the minced leek with the ☆ ingredients to create miso and leek sauce.
  2. Heat oil in a pan over medium heat. Lay the salmon in the pan skin side down, and brown well so it can be served skin side up and will look nice.
  3. Turn the fish over and brown it while spreading the miso leek paste over the skin. Cover the pan with a lid and cook over low heat for about 3 minutes. Then just serve the salmon and you are done!
